| Actor | Film / Series | Character | Years Active in Role |
|---|---|---|---|
| Logan Lerman | Percy Jackson & the Olympians: The Lightning Thief | Percy Jackson | 2010 |
| Logan Lerman | Percy Jackson: Sea of Monsters | Percy Jackson | 2013 |

Who played Percy Jackson in the 2010 film adaptation?
Logan Lerman portrayed Percy Jackson in Percy Jackson & the Olympians: The Lightning Thief, bringing a teenage perspective to the demigod role.
